BASED IN SOUTH EAST ENGLAND

This opportunity is for a UK-based private limited company operating as a market-leading manufacturer and supplier. The business has achieved three consecutive years of profitable trading to the 31 January year-end, with turnover between £4.78m and £5.47m over that period.
The company benefits from a strong market presence, both offline and online, with significant investment in manufacturing capacity, logistics infrastructure, and customer service. It serves a large and loyal B2C customer base, complemented by a growing B2B presence. Operations are supported by an 85,000 sq ft manufacturing facility and a dedicated in-house delivery fleet.

  • 820,000 website visitors in the last 12 months averaging 68,333 per month
  • 27,000 ecommerce orders in the last 12 months conversion rate of 3.3%
  • Over 100,000 total orders processed via ecommerce platform
  • Delivery handled entirely via own fleet for full service control
  • Large B2C customer base with a growing B2B segment
  • Operates from 85,000 sq ft facility with significant production capacity
  • Workforce expected to remain in place postsale

The business presents acquirers with an established, asset-backed platform in a niche market segment, offering strong growth potential through market expansion, product diversification, and operational optimisation.
Over the past three financial years to 31 January, the company has delivered steady revenues and consistent profitability. Turnover increased from £4.78m in FY23 to £5.47m in FY24, before closing at £5.36m in FY25. Gross margins have remained strong, ranging between 32.5% and 36.9%, supported by disciplined cost control.
EBITDA has grown from £190k in FY23 to £470k in FY24, with a solid £423k achieved in FY25, demonstrating robust underlying earnings. Net profit after tax has also improved over the period, rising from £75k in FY23 to £283k in FY24, and recording £206k in FY25.
Tangible fixed assets have increased from £390k in FY23 to £522k in FY25, reflecting continued investment in manufacturing capacity, while net assets stood at £199k at the most recent year-end.
No individual customer generates more than 3% of the company's income per annum, reducing reliance on any single client and supporting revenue stability.
The business operates within the UK fencing market, which is forecast to expand at a compound annual growth rate of 6% through to 2032, providing a favourable backdrop for future growth under new ownership.
